溫馨提示×

Linux Python版本管理最佳實踐

小樊
87
2024-08-07 01:06:15
欄目: 編程語言

在Linux系統(tǒng)上進行Python版本管理的最佳實踐是使用虛擬環(huán)境(virtualenv)或者conda環(huán)境。這樣可以避免不同的項目之間版本沖突,并且能夠輕松管理不同Python版本。

以下是最佳實踐步驟:

  1. 安裝virtualenv或conda環(huán)境:

對于virtualenv,可以使用以下命令安裝:

pip install virtualenv

對于conda環(huán)境,可以使用以下命令安裝:

conda install -c anaconda virtualenv
  1. 創(chuàng)建虛擬環(huán)境:

使用virtualenv創(chuàng)建虛擬環(huán)境:

virtualenv venv

使用conda創(chuàng)建虛擬環(huán)境:

conda create -n myenv python=3.8
  1. 激活虛擬環(huán)境:

對于virtualenv:

source venv/bin/activate

對于conda:

conda activate myenv

激活虛擬環(huán)境后,安裝所需的Python包:

pip install package_name
  1. 在虛擬環(huán)境中運行Python程序:
python your_program.py
  1. 退出虛擬環(huán)境:

對于virtualenv:

deactivate

對于conda:

conda deactivate

通過使用虛擬環(huán)境,可以輕松管理不同的Python版本和依賴包,確保項目之間不會出現(xiàn)沖突,并且保持系統(tǒng)干凈整潔。

0